Transaction 66fcd20fcbd0252b2516da82b4baa0200b5ec21ffb98fecdb20027167df88a4b
1 Input
1 Output
-
66fcd20fcbd0252b2516da82b4baa0200b5ec21ffb98fecdb20027167df88a4b:0
- value
- 15106048
- script pubkey
- OP_0 OP_PUSHBYTES_20 a9983cf3c5b6dc197a43ed2c9a19a078c5a91b57
- address
- bc1q4xvreu79kmwpj7jra5kf5xdq0rz6jx6h4f6scx